Fundraising for a new station


In spite of being a small team, the group of volunteers collecting funds for Kanehsatake’s community radio station were successful in raising big. After being brought back on air following extensive damage to its station in 2017, Reviving Kanehsatà:ke Radio (RKR) embarked on a mission to build-up the community’s one and only broadcaster. “We need a way for the community to be able to communicate information with one another and this is why we have to get our radio station up and running,” he said.
